Abstract

A duplex coating scheme and associated method of formation, which includes a siloxane based soft coating and a plasma based SiOxCy hard coating used in combination to improve the durability of acrylic substrates used in aircraft window applications.

Claims

exact text as granted — not AI-modified
1 . A duplex coating comprising:
 a substrate;   a soft coating; and   a hard coating;   said soft coating applied to a surface of said substrate, said hard coating applied to said soft coating.   
     
     
         2 . The duplex coating of  claim 1 , wherein said substrate comprises an acrylic substrate. 
     
     
         3 . The duplex coating of  claim 2 , wherein said acrylic substrate comprises a stretched acrylic substrate. 
     
     
         4 . The duplex coating of  claim 1 , wherein the soft coating comprises a polysiloxane adherent coating. 
     
     
         5 . The duplex coating of  claim 1 , wherein the soft coating comprises a thickness of between about 4 and 5 microns. 
     
     
         6 . The duplex coating of  claim 1 , wherein the hard coating comprises a plasma CVD based coating containing silicon. 
     
     
         7 . The duplex coating of  claim 1 , wherein the hard coating comprises a thickness of between about 4 and 5 microns. 
     
     
         8 . The duplex coating of  claim 1 , wherein the hard coating comprises a Diamondshield coating. 
     
     
         9 . A duplex coating comprising:
 a stretched acrylic substrate;   a polysiloxane adherent coating; and   a plasma CVD based coating containing silicon;   said polysiloxane adherent coating applied to a surface of said stretched acrylic substrate, said plasma CVD based coating containing silicon deposited on said polysiloxane coated stretched acrylic substrate.   
     
     
         10 . The duplex coating of  claim 9 , wherein the polysiloxane adherent coating comprises a thickness of between about 4 and 5 microns. 
     
     
         11 . The duplex coating of  claim 9 , wherein the plasma CVD based coating containing silicon comprises a thickness of between about 4 and 5 microns. 
     
     
         12 . The duplex coating of  claim 9 , wherein the plasma CVD based coating containing silicon comprises a Diamondshield coating.
